How to encrypt existing hard drives
Hello
I have readyNAS 316 and want to know how I can encrypt my hard drives? They have been in use for last couple of years so have lots of data. I need to do this to be GDPR compliant.

As far as I know, there is no way to do this in-place. You'll need to destroy the current volume and create a new encrypted one (and then restore the data from backup).
